Output 9ca69f8abcd88af74ca6fd5341dceb70e5a19ebe1a3b13d0d4b341dbdaf6a2c2:1

value
659600
script pubkey
OP_0 OP_PUSHBYTES_20 84bd7504c3024ddfa661570588ad129b6c2345f9
address
bc1qsj7h2pxrqfxalfnp2uzc3tgjndkzx30eeh8u8c
transaction
9ca69f8abcd88af74ca6fd5341dceb70e5a19ebe1a3b13d0d4b341dbdaf6a2c2
confirmations
325883
spent
true